About the Role

We are seeking a Therapeutic Specialist to join our Northern Territory team in Darwin or Alice Springs. The Therapeutic Specialist plays a critical role in overseeing and coordinating the functions within the Intensive Therapeutic Care programs undertaken by Life Without Barriers.

As a Therapeutic Specialist you will provide therapeutic support and intervention development for Children & Young People in our care who have backgrounds of complex trauma, abuse and/or neglect, and in some cases physical and/or psychosocial disabilities requiring support. You will also deliver specialist support to our care teams through practice support and leading reflective practice sessions.

Key Responsibilities

  • Provide evidence informed advice and recommendations on understanding and minimising negative impacts of trauma, promoting healthy age-appropriate development and building and strengthening skills and competency.
  • Provide evidence informed training and support for carers and staff regarding therapeutic support.
  • Lead implementation, maintenance and monitoring of Children and Residential Experiences (CARE) principles and practice and Therapeutic Crisis Intervention (TCI) 
  • Provide expertise and support to House Managers & Therapeutic Support Workers in the formulation and ongoing management of Therapeutic Care Plans, and to ensure purposeful supports are provided in line with CARE principals
  • Coordinate preventative strategies to ensure continuity of care and mitigate placement breakdowns
  • Advocate on behalf of Children & Young People by engaging agencies and organisations to support consistent therapeutic practice
  • Contribute to client matching and intake assessment processes and support the transition of Children & Young People into homes

Skills & Experience

  • Tertiary qualifications in Psychology, Social Work,  Mental Health Nursing or other related discipline. 
  • Current registration or eligibility for registration with the professional body relevant to your qualification. 
  • Completed, currently completing or agreement to undertake a unit of learning consistent with nationally recognised competency CHCDIS016 - Develop and promote position person-centred behaviour supports. 
  • Demonstrated experience in working with children or young people in our of home care who have experienced trauma, abuse and/or neglect
  • Ability to develop and promote positive person-centred behaviour supports
  • Strong understanding of the impact of trauma and complex behaviours
  • Current Driver’s Licence
